The PHAT Conference TM

          The PHAT (Promoting Healthy Active Teens) Conference was created in 2006 by teens and adult advisors representing communities across Hampton Roads, Virginia. Our passion continues today with our mission to promote healthy lifestyles, fitness and nutrition. The program's thrust is focused on building and sustaining healthy communities. 

         During the course of the conference's planning, the teens are encouraged to use critical thinking skills to problem-solve. The interactive activities and workshop topics are decided by the teens to assure we are meeting the needs of their peers and community. 

          Our event is presented by the Cooper-Mercer Institute (CMI) a nonprofit organization that supports community programs and projects for vulnerable populations.  Donations for the PHAT Conference can be made through CMI.
